Low-Flow Toilets

When you choose to upgrade to low-flow toilets, you not only save water but also reduce your utility bills greatly. These toilets use considerably less water per flush compared to traditional models, making them an eco-friendly choice for your home.

You’ll find that modern low-flow toilets flush effectively, ensuring cleanliness without wasting resources.

Installing these fixtures can lead to substantial savings on your water bill, freeing up funds for other household necessities. Plus, many local utility companies even offer rebates for installing water-efficient fixtures, adding to your savings.

With low-flow toilets, you’re contributing to environmental conservation while enhancing your home’s value. They’re available in various styles and designs, ensuring you don’t have to compromise on aesthetics. Installation Tips and Tricks

Before you plunge into installing your new water-saving showerhead, gather the right tools to make the process smooth and efficient.

You’ll need an adjustable wrench, plumber’s tape, and a cloth to protect the finish.

Start by turning off the water supply and removing the old showerhead. Wrap the threads of the pipe with plumber’s tape to prevent leaks.

Next, align the water-saving showerhead with the pipe and hand-tighten it. Avoid over-tightening, as this can damage the fixtures.

Once it’s secure, turn the water back on and check for leaks. If everything’s dry, enjoy your new eco-friendly showerhead, knowing you’re saving water and money without sacrificing performance!

Faucet Aerators

Many homeowners may not realize that simple upgrades, like faucet aerators, can greatly enhance water efficiency in their plumbing systems.

Installing aerators on your bathroom faucets reduces water flow without sacrificing pressure. This means you can enjoy a satisfying wash while using less water—helping both your wallet and the environment.

Faucet aerators can cut your water usage by up to 50%, which adds up considerably over time.

They’re easy to install, often requiring no tools, and they come in various styles to match your fixtures.

Tankless Water Heaters

Upgrading to a tankless water heater can further enhance your home’s water efficiency, providing hot water on demand without the energy waste associated with traditional storage tanks.

These compact units heat water as you need it, eliminating the standby energy loss that occurs with bulky tanks. You’ll enjoy an endless supply of hot water, perfect for busy mornings or family gatherings.

Installing a tankless water heater can also save you money on energy bills over time, making it a smart investment for your home. Plus, many models are designed to last longer than conventional heaters, reducing the need for frequent replacements.

Maintenance and Care Tips

Maintaining your greywater recycling system is essential for its efficiency and longevity. Start by regularly checking filters and cleaning them to prevent clogs.

Ascertain that the pipes are free from debris and inspect for leaks, as even small issues can impact performance. It’s also a good idea to monitor the water quality; if you notice any unusual odors or discoloration, investigate immediately.

Run the system periodically, even if you’re not using it regularly, to keep everything functioning smoothly. Additionally, avoid using harsh chemicals in your household, as they can disrupt the recycling process.

Finally, schedule annual inspections with a professional plumber to ascertain that your system remains in top condition and complies with local regulations.
